Output 3e51b73d77b607f7d2ca63295d0d5013f8d9d183747f5850729af089a8de487e:1

value
186600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0261b863ec4999fc61e158d9eb7c1844f66832e OP_EQUAL
address
3N8CwGe9MeaVpSArjNbvxHYf67nfNtKYbw
transaction
3e51b73d77b607f7d2ca63295d0d5013f8d9d183747f5850729af089a8de487e
spent
true